When asked about destinations that most frequently provide the most attractive bargains or best values for summer travel, AAA travel agency managers identified the following: Las Vegas; Orlando/Walt Disney World, Fla.; Branson, Missouri; Anaheim/Disneyland; and San Francisco. International destinations identified as best for bargains and value are: the Caribbean; European Cruises; Punta Cana, Dominican Republic; South America; and Costa Rica.
When comparing AAA’s 2007 and 2008 summer travel surveys, AAA travel agency managers identified the following locations as this summer’s top five domestic and international vacation destinations:
Domestic by air:
(Excluding Canada & Mexico)
2008
1. Orlando
2. Las Vegas
3. New York
4. Los Angeles
5. Washington, D.C.
2007
1. Orlando
2. Las Vegas
3. Seattle
4. New York
5. Los Angeles/Orange County
International by air:
2008
1. Rome
2. London
3. Cancun
4. Dublin
5. Vancouver
2007
1. Rome
2. London
3. Vancouver
4. Cancun
5. Paris
In addition, domestic “hot spots” for this summer include: New Mexico; San Antonio, Texas; Albuquerque, New Mexico; Oregon; and Miami/South Beach. International “hot spots” include: Croatia; Montenegro; Vietnam; Cinque Terra, Italy; and Douro River, Portugal.
